Combining Like Terms

Lesson Description

Students learn to simplify an expression by combining like terms. For example, to simplify 5a + 7b - a - 2b, combine the like terms 5a - 1a, to get 4a, and combine the like terms 7b - 2b, to get 5b. So 5a + 7b - a - 2b simplifies to 4a + 5b. To simplify 2x^2 - 3x + 12 + 4x - 5x^2, combine the like terms 2x^2 - 5x^2, to get -3x^2, and combine the like terms -3x + 4x, to get 1x. So 2x^2 - 3x + 12 + 4x - 5x^2 simplifies to -3x^2 + 1x + 12.
